Understanding Crypto Coin Ledgers
A crypto coin ledger is a secure digital record book that chronologically logs all transactions involving a particular cryptocurrency. Each ledger is decentralized, meaning it is not controlled by any single entity. Instead, it is maintained by a network of computers spread across the globe, ensuring the integrity and transparency of the data.

FAQs
Is it safe to use a crypto coin ledger?
Yes, reputable ledgers are highly secure and protect your crypto assets with robust encryption and security protocols.
How do I choose the right ledger for me?
Consider your security requirements, the number of coins you plan to store, and the features that are important to you.
Is it possible to recover my crypto assets if I lose my ledger?
Yes, if you have a backup of your seed phrase or private key, you can recover your assets on a new ledger.
What is the best way to store a crypto coin ledger?
Store your ledger in a secure location and make sure to back up your seed phrase or private key in multiple locations.
